The XXI Olympic Winter Games will be held in Canada in February 2010. Vancouver, British Columbia is the host city for the 2010 Winter Olympics. This will be the third time Canada has hosted the Games. The 1976 Summer Games was held in Montreal. The 1988 Winter Games were held in Calgary. The 2010 Games will be the first ever to have their Opening Ceremony held indoors.


The mascots for the 2010 Games were unveiled in 2007. They were inspired by First Nations' legends. First Nations are the Pacific Northwest's Native American people. The mascots are named Miga, Quatchi, and Sumi.
